Statement of Religious Beliefs, Theory and Practice

"Now the company of those who believed were of one heart
and soul, and no one said that any of the things which co
possessed was co's own, but they held everything in common...
and distribution was made to each as any had need."

- From the Acts of the Apostles

There is one God, the Eternal, the Only Being: God is One with the Universe: nothing else exists but God.

There is one Holy Book, the Sacred Manuscript of Nature, the only Scripture which can enlighten the reader.

There is one Religion, the unswerving progress toward the ideal, which fulfills the life's purpose of every soul.

There is one Law, the Law of Love, which can be observed by a selfless conscience together with a sense of awakening justice.

There is one Moral Principle, the love which springs forth from self-control for the sake of others, and blooms in deeds of kindness.

There is one Truth, the true knowledge of our being, within and without, which is the essence of all wisdom.

There is one Path, the annihilation of the false ego in the real, which raises the mortal to immortality and in which resides all perfection.

Because we are one with God, we are also one with each other. Whatever harms any of us harms us all. Whatever lowers one of us lowers us all. Therefore we endeavor:
To eliminate hierarchy in relationships between people.

To practice nonviolence in our personal, interpersonal, and political lives.

To respect and preserve the natural environment for the use of our own and other species, now and in the future.

To confront and defeat classism, racism, ageism, patriarchy, and other forms of oppression, both in ourselves and in other people.

To practice community of property, sharing all that we are and have and can produce with on another.
